Nina Battle Ball
Nina Battle Ball, 88, formerly of 4630 Woodleaf Road, died Monday (July 6, 1998) at Brian Center and Rehabilitation, Salisbury, after several years of declining health.
Born March 19, 1910, in Swain County, Mrs. Ball, a daughter of the late Thomas Milton and Arie Grant Battle, was educated in the Buncombe County schools. Retired in 1968 from Western Carolina University, she had been a dietitian for food services for 10 years. She was a member of Enon Baptist Church, the Mary Ella Bible Class and Leverne Applewhite Circle.
Her husband, Reginald Anderson Ball, died March 16, 1993.
Survivors include son Reginald E. Ball, Linwood; daughter, Salisbury; sisters Mrs. Mitch (Mary) Plemmons, Mrs. Hillard (Bonnie) Ingle and Mrs. Harry (Dot) Robinson, all of West Asheville; six grandchildren; and four great-grandchildren.
